On Mon, 9 Sep 2002, Vince Mounts wrote:
> Is there some way to get bash to log all of its input and output to a file?
> I looked through man and info but if it was there I missed it.
The input to bash is already logged in ~/.bash_history. If you want to
log both the input and the output, consider using screen:
